Abstract
The utility model relates to a control switch, and particularly relates to a load isolating switch. The load isolating switch mainly solves the technical problems that in the prior art, the existing load switch is used in a middle-high voltage circuit, and high-energy arc can be produced when the circuit is cut off because of larger current, thus the device becomes very dangerous. The control switch provided by the utility model comprises a base (1), and is characterized in that the base (1) is internally provided with an arc extinguishing chamber (2), the arc extinguish chamber is internally provided with an arc extinguishing plate (3), the arc extinguishing chamber (2) is further internally provided with a static contact (4) and a movable contact (5) in a symmetrical mode, the movable contact is connected with a rotatable handle (7) by a transmission piece (6), and the static contact and the movable contact are both connected with a spring piece (8).

The utility model content
The utility model provides a kind of isolation on-load switch; It mainly is to solve the existing in prior technology on-load switch to be used in the mesohigh circuit; Because electric current is bigger, in disjunction, can produces high-octane electric arc, thereby equipment is had the technical problem of very big danger etc.
The above-mentioned technical problem of the utility model mainly is able to solve through following technical proposals:
A kind of isolation on-load switch of the utility model; Comprise pedestal; Be provided with arc control device in the described pedestal, be provided with arc quenching plate in the arc control device, also be arranged with fixed contact and moving contact in the arc control device; Moving contact is connected with rotatable handle through driving member, and fixed contact, moving contact all are connected with spring leaf.Behind the turning handle,, can make the moving contact move left and right, when moving contact and fixed contact carry out contacting, be "on" position through driving member.Spring leaf can reset moving contact.The two ends of pedestal can connect input terminal and outlet terminal, and input terminal, outlet terminal are communicated with fixed contact, moving contact respectively.
As preferably, described handle is connected with retainer spring, and retainer spring is located in the lid, and lid is connected on the pedestal.When handle turned to certain position, retainer spring can be fixed on certain position with handle, prevented the handle revolution of skidding.
As preferably, described driving member connects handle through shaft coupling, connector.Through shaft coupling, connector, make that the assembling of handle is simpler, rotate also more smooth and easy.
Therefore, the utility model is through handle interlock moving contact, contact connection through putting between moving contact and the fixed contact, thereby make that the disjunction of electric current is comparatively simple, and moving contact and fixed contact is located in the arc control device, can not produce danger, and is simple and reasonable for structure.

Embodiment
Pass through embodiment below, and combine accompanying drawing, do further bright specifically the technical scheme of the utility model.
Embodiment: a kind of isolation on-load switch of this example; Like Fig. 1, Fig. 2, a pedestal 1 is arranged, be provided with arc control device 2 in the pedestal; Be provided with arc quenching plate 3 in the arc control device; Also be arranged with fixed contact 4 and moving contact 5 in the arc control device, moving contact is connected with rotatable handle 7 through driving member 6, and driving member connects handle 7 through shaft coupling 11, connector 12.Handle is connected with retainer spring 9, and retainer spring is located in the lid 10, and lid is connected on the pedestal.Fixed contact, moving contact all are connected with spring leaf 8.
During use, moving contact at first carries out contacting with fixed contact 4, realizes "on" position.Turning handle 7, under the effect of driving member 6, moving contact moves right, and moving contact separates with fixed contact, thereby realizes separating brake.
